About the position

The Senior Compliance & Privacy Analyst at SJRMC serves as a regulatory privacy and compliance specialist, responsible for managing inquiries related to compliance topics, conducting research, and assisting with the implementation and maintenance of the compliance program. This role involves performing audits, reviewing risk metrics, developing policies, conducting training, and enhancing compliance initiatives.

Responsibilities

  • Assist and manage investigations for compliance and privacy concerns and/or violations through corrective actions.
  • Coordinate, monitor, and audit documentation focusing on medical necessity reviews and clinical documentation to ensure compliance with regulatory guidelines and internal policies.
  • Provide recommendations for educational opportunities and/or process improvement.
  • Conduct new caregiver orientation and ongoing training for compliance and privacy.
  • Serve as a resource for all caregivers regarding compliance and privacy guidance.
  • Analyze audit results to identify patterns, trends, or variations in coding and documentation practices and make recommendations for improvement.
  • Prepare quarterly compliance metric and audit reports for all findings and provide appropriate recommendations.
  • Ensure corrections are communicated to the Clinic Billing Office in a timely manner and track corrections, trends, and financial impact.
  • Collaborate with various departments and Compliance leadership to develop process improvement and corrective action plans based on risk assessments and audit findings.
  • Perform trend analyses to identify and analyze clinical and compliance patterns in coding and documentation practices.
  • Assist with policy and procedure development and revisions for Compliance and Privacy areas.
  • Maintain current knowledge of federal and state regulations and guidelines, keeping abreast of changes affecting healthcare systems.
  • Contribute as a voting member of the Compliance Committee and Audit and Risk Assessment Committee.
  • Perform back-up coverage for system administration functions for the SJRMC contract approval and management platform and PolicyTech.

Requirements

  • Associate degree
  • Minimum of three (3) years' experience in healthcare compliance or auditing
  • Minimum of three (3) years' experience in privacy regulations and investigations
  • Experience in healthcare
  • Must achieve CHC certification within twelve (12) months from date of hire

Nice-to-haves

  • Bachelor's degree
  • Possess one (1) of the following certifications: CHC, CHPC, CPC, CCS, or equivalent certifications
  • Clinical experience working in a hospital environment
  • Experience and thorough understanding of the False Claims Act
